Transaction ece99f3d0888435ef1a5cbb4c63cc0f39b90caa1f5406feada1f7ff22e4b8667
1 Input
1 Output
-
ece99f3d0888435ef1a5cbb4c63cc0f39b90caa1f5406feada1f7ff22e4b8667:0
- value
- 1073701
- script pubkey
- OP_0 OP_PUSHBYTES_20 aba03d423e2747ce0d9e05fa0ef3d581fc716f13
- address
- bc1q4wsr6s37yaruurv7qhaqau74s878zmcn6u22nh